Course Details
- Understanding Fibromyalgia: Prevalence, Diagnosis, and Impact
- Pharmacological Interventions for Fibromyalgia
- Non-Pharmacological Approaches: Physical Therapy and Exercise
- Mind-Body Techniques: Cognitive Behavioral Therapy and Mindfulness
- Alternative and Complementary Therapies for Fibromyalgia
- Nutritional Guidelines and Supplementation Strategies
- Patient Education and Self-Management Skills
- Multidisciplinary Approaches to Fibromyalgia Management
- Case Studies and Practical Applications
- Emerging Trends and Research in Fibromyalgia Pain Management
